Fascia Installation in Overland Park, KS

Fascia installation involves attaching a horizontal board along the edge of the roofline, serving both functional and aesthetic purposes. This service typically covers projects such as replacing damaged or rotting fascia boards, upgrading existing fascia for improved curb appeal, or preparing the roofline for new siding or roofing materials. Property owners interested in fascia installation should consider the condition of their current fascia, the materials they prefer, and how the new fascia will complement the overall appearance of the home.

Before requesting fascia installation, homeowners often want to understand the scope of work involved, including the type of materials available-such as wood, vinyl, or aluminum-and how they may impact maintenance and durability. It’s also helpful to consider the compatibility of fascia with existing roofing components and any necessary repairs to underlying structures. Clarifying these details can ensure the project meets aesthetic preferences and functional needs, resulting in a finished look that enhances the property's exterior.

Fascia Installation Questions

What is fascia installation? Fascia installation involves attaching boards to the edges of roof rafters to protect the roof and create a finished look.

Why is fascia important for a home? Fascia helps prevent water damage, protects roof structures, and enhances the property's curb appeal.

What types of materials are used for fascia? Common materials include wood, vinyl, and aluminum, each offering different durability and aesthetic options.

When should fascia be replaced or upgraded? Fascia should be replaced if it shows signs of rotting, warping, or damage, typically during roof repairs or renovations.
